Название | Квантовые операции и вычисления: От основ до практики. Искусство квантовых состояний |
---|---|
Автор произведения | ИВВ |
Жанр | |
Серия | |
Издательство | |
Год выпуска | 0 |
isbn | 9785006232358 |
Использование операций сдвига фазы открывает дополнительные возможности для манипуляции и обработки кубитов в квантовых вычислениях, что делает их более мощными и эффективными по сравнению с классическими вычислениями.
3. Операция T (вентиль T): Она также изменяет фазу состояний, но на угол π/4. Она часто используется в комбинации с другими операциями для сложных манипуляций состояниями кубитов.
Математически, операция T определяется следующим образом:
T|0⟩ = |0⟩,
T|1⟩ = (1 + i) |1⟩ / sqrt (2).
Операция T аналогична операции S, но с большим углом поворота фазы на π/4. Это позволяет нам выполнять более сложные манипуляции с фазами кубитов.
Операция T обычно используется в комбинации с другими операциями, такими как H, CNOT и SWAP, для выполнения более сложных вычислений. Например, комбинация операций H, CNOT и T может быть использована для создания уникального состояния кубитов или для выполнения специфических операций.
Использование операции T в комбинации с другими операциями позволяет выполнять различные вычисления, включая квантовые фурье-преобразования, управляемую фазовую оценку и другие квантовые алгоритмы. Комбинирование операций T и CNOT, например, может создать энтанглированные состояния кубитов и использоваться для выполнения квантовых логических операций.
Операция T является одной из важных операций квантовых вычислений, которая позволяет нам более эффективно и точно манипулировать фазами и состояниями кубитов. Она открывает новые возможности для выполнения сложных вычислений, которые не могут быть выполнены с помощью классических операций.
4. Операция CNOT (контролируемый не): Это контролируемая операция, которая изменяет состояние второго кубита в зависимости от состояния первого кубита.
Операция CNOT определяется следующим образом:
CNOT|00⟩ = |00⟩,
CNOT|01⟩ = |01⟩,
CNOT|10⟩ = |11⟩,
CNOT|11⟩ = |10⟩.
Операция CNOT является контролируемой вентилем и меняет состояние второго кубита только в случае, когда первый кубит находится в состоянии |1⟩. Если первый кубит находится в состоянии |0⟩, то второй кубит остается нетронутым.
Эта операция позволяет создавать взаимодействия между кубитами и реализовывать произвольные квантовые логические вентили. Контролируемый не-вентиль может быть использован для выполнения операций копирования, инверсии, исключающего ИЛИ и других логических операций. Это делает его основным строительным блоком для многих квантовых алгоритмов.
Операции, включая CNOT, могут быть комбинированы для создания сложных состояний и выполнения специфических операций. Например, комбинация операций H и CNOT может создать энтанглированные состояния кубитов,